Miss. Rep. Opposes More School Funding Because 'Welfare Crazy Checks' For 'Blacks' Don't Work

Mississippi state Rep. Gene Alday (R) said recently that he opposes increases in education funding, citing "crazy welfare checks" that he doesn't think benefit the state.

"I don’t see any schools hurting," Alday (pictured on the right) said in an interview with the Clarion-Ledger highlighted by ThinkProgress. "The people are electing superintendents that don’t know anything about education."

"I come from a town where all the blacks are getting food stamps and what I call 'welfare crazy checks.' They don’t work," he continued.

The state lawmaker then complained that he recently had a long wait in a hospital emergency room. "I laid in there for hours because they (blacks) were in there being treated for gunshots," he said.

11. Mississippi is NUMBER ONE - as a Federal welfare State:
Sun Feb 15, 2015, 03:25 PM
Feb 2015
1. Mississippi

Return on Taxpayer Investment: $3.07
Funding as Percentage of Revenue: 45.8 percent
Federal Employees Per Capita: 8.67

Along with its neighbors Louisiana and Alabama, Mississippi is heavily assisted with federal dollars. So much so that WalletHub’s calculations place them at the top of the list for the most dependent on Washington for subsistence. Mississippi suffers from some serious socio-economic issues, including having the highest poverty rate and one of the lowest income rates in the country.

These are problems that have plagued the state for a long time, and there doesn’t appear to be any hope for change in the near future. There are a few things that capture federal funding that add to the state’s total, including several military bases, but the major issue appears to be the lack of jobs and opportunity suffered by the state’s citizens.
